我正在执行这个openrowset函数:
SELECT * FROM OPENROWSET('Microsoft.ACE.OLEDB.12.0',
'Excel 12.0;Database=C:\Users\JCPABALAN\Desktop\Data Migration\ListOfDiscards.xlsx;HDR=YES',
'SELECT * FROM [Sheet1$]')
但它给了我以下错误
OLE DB提供程序"Microsoft.ACE.OLEDB.12.0“用于链接服务器”返回消息“Microsof
EXEC sp_configure 'show advanced options', 1
RECONFIGURE
GO
EXEC sp_configure 'ad hoc distributed queries', 1
RECONFIGURE
GO
USE [master]
GO
EXEC master.dbo.sp_MSset_oledb_prop N'Microsoft.ACE.OLEDB.12.0', N'AllowInProcess', 1
GO
EXEC master.dbo.sp_MSset_oledb
我在使用ACE_SPIPE_Connector (ACE)将C++客户端连接到.NET服务器时遇到问题。虽然对address .\pipe\pipename的回显测试可以正常工作,但我怀疑我的C++代码在使用ACE库时出现了问题。
以下是.NET服务器代码:
var server = new NamedPipeServerStream("acepipe");
server.WaitForConnection();
StreamReader reader = new StreamReader(server);
var line = reader.ReadLine();
Con
使用案例是在使用Angular9构建的UI中显示服务器日志。我正在使用ACE编辑器显示http调用时从服务器接收到的文本内容,服务器使用最近1000行日志进行响应,以验证我在chrome dev工具中查看文本内容所做的console.log()。Console output received from server 在将相同的内容加载到编辑器时,我注意到有特殊字符 Ace editor content while using in text mode 附件中有2个截图以供比较 HTML内容 <div ace-editor #codeEditor style="min-hei
这在这里是一个常见的问题,但是没有一个解决方案解决了我的问题,所以它是这样的:
我正在向我的rails4应用程序添加ace.js,所以我所做的是
- Added vendor/assets/ace/ace.js
- Created vendor/assets/ace/index.js , with content
//= require ace
- Added the following to my production.rb
config.assets.precompile += %w( index.js )
config.assets.paths << Ra
我使用32位Server 2008和FoxPro OLE DB驱动程序是32位.
我有一个大的.DBF文件,我想要导入到Server表中。我做了很多研究,也尝试过很多建议,但都没有完全奏效。
到目前为止,对我更有效的代码是:
select DCOM
from openrowset('VFPOLEDB','D:\x09150614.DBF';'';'','SELECT * FROM x09150614')
但是,当我想选择另一列时:
select vfobserdol
from openrowset('V
所以我最初为.NET 4.5创建了这个程序,但后来发现我为其制作的目标机器是.NET 3.5。当我试图连接到数据库时,我会得到以下错误:
System.InvalidOperationException: The 'Microsoft.ACE.OLEDB.12.0' provier is not registered on the local machine.
我已经在机器上安装了AccessDatabaseEngine.exe (2010),但仍然收到相同的错误消息。有人知道我做错了什么吗?代码中的连接字符串如下所示:
connection.ConnectionString